From e4f5c1bf8f6f6fe0bb4c743452bf8288033e80ba Mon Sep 17 00:00:00 2001 From: Liu Yuan Date: Tue, 6 Aug 2013 14:44:37 +0800 Subject: sheepdog: add missing .bdrv_has_zero_init Commit 3ac21627 changed the behaviour of bdrv_has_zero_init() to default to 0. In the review for Sheepdog it turned out that enabling it is safe, so that commit updated one BlockDriver definition of sheepdog to use bdrv_has_zero_init_1, missed however that there are more BlockDrivers in the driver. Fix these now. Cc: Kevin Wolf Cc: Stefan Hajnoczi Signed-off-by: Liu Yuan Reviewed-by: MORITA Kazutaka Signed-off-by: Kevin Wolf --- block/sheepdog.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/block/sheepdog.c b/block/sheepdog.c index a506137..afe0533 100644 --- a/block/sheepdog.c +++ b/block/sheepdog.c @@ -2347,6 +2347,7 @@ static BlockDriver bdrv_sheepdog = { .bdrv_file_open = sd_open, .bdrv_close = sd_close, .bdrv_create = sd_create, + .bdrv_has_zero_init = bdrv_has_zero_init_1, .bdrv_getlength = sd_getlength, .bdrv_truncate = sd_truncate, @@ -2374,6 +2375,7 @@ static BlockDriver bdrv_sheepdog_tcp = { .bdrv_file_open = sd_open, .bdrv_close = sd_close, .bdrv_create = sd_create, + .bdrv_has_zero_init = bdrv_has_zero_init_1, .bdrv_getlength = sd_getlength, .bdrv_truncate = sd_truncate, -- cgit v1.1